L.A. Heritage To Be Celebrated
Tweet The L.A. Heritage Alliance will hold Los Angeles Heritage Day on Sunday, March 22, from 11 a.m. to 4 p.m. at Heritage Square Museum in Highland Park. Among the day’s highlights will be historic homes, a scavenger hunt, other activities for children and families, panel discussions on culture and preservation, tips for promoting local heritage and information about local preservation organizations, museums, and historical societies.
